Who Dined At Dan Tana’s?

June 25th, 2008 // 2 Comments

Find out who the flora-wearing babe by clicking on the photo (and check out the gallery of 16 photos).

It’s the lovable Cameron Diaz!

By Michael Prieve

  1. yikes

    She looks like Ellen Degeneres.

  2. chet

    I think it’s cool that she takes home leftovers!

Leave A Comment